NO GALLERY – Los Angeles  

Working with the gallery owner, this renovation enhances the building’s original architectural character while preserving key historical elements. The restored terrazzo flooring and the exposed concrete highlights decades of layered finishes, creating a striking brutalist-inspired interior. A custom slab 12-foot door serves as a dramatic focal point in the main gallery, unifying the space with a contemporary aesthetic. The space has been optimized for various installations, utilizing concealed solid paneled walls which provide a dynamic and adaptable exhibition area.
